We’re happy to answer plant questions or help you with order questions. Please fill out the form below. If you need immediate assistance, please call us at 603-332-4565
Inquire Form
Contact our Customer Services team by completing the form. We will endeavour to respond within 24 hours.
Contact Us
Need help? Check out our FAQ page